Beneath the moon's gentle glow, Daksha stepped out, draped in an elegant black cloak. Her wavy hair flowed freely, dancing with the soft night breeze. Her steps were akin to a swan's dance, tracing the moonlit path. At the end of the stone terrace, Archy stood in a black shirt, reflecting a somber mood. Their eyes met, united in the meaningful silence of the night.
Their rendezvous in the memory-laden garden set the stage for a profound conversation about love, dreams, and reality. Under the white rose pergola, they spoke of elusive happiness and old wounds yet to heal. In the labyrinth of towering plants, they revealed their feelings and fears, seeking answers in the quiet night.
Bound by complicated love and moral burdens, they sought a way out of life's labyrinth. The brave Daksha and the steadfast Archy endeavored to balance hope with reality, dreams with responsibilities. They spoke of a cherished past, a hopeful present, and an uncertain future.
As the night deepened and time marched on, they had to decide whether to continue their journey together or choose separate paths. Their story was about love tested by time, hope that burned bright in darkness, and the courage to face reality without surrender.
Under the shining stars, Daksha and Archy etched unforgettable memories, walking together through a night filled with beauty and sorrow. A journey that taught them the meaning of love and the bravery to face destiny.
